Rosstat: Smartphones fell 1.5% during the week, TV prices fell 0.9%
MOSCOW, May 25 – RIA Novosti. According to Rosstat, from May 14 to May 20, the prices of smartphones in Russia increased by 1.5%, TVs – by 0.9%, and vacuum cleaners by 0.5%.
“Smartphone prices fell 1.5% and TV prices fell 0.9%,” the report says. At the same time, vacuum cleaner prices rose 0.5% in the same period.
In total, since the beginning of the year in Russia, the prices of smartphones have increased by 9%, TVs by 7.6% and vacuum cleaners by 14.6%.
Western countries began to impose a new set of harsh sanctions against Russia in response to a special operation against Ukraine. In this regard, a number of foreign equipment manufacturers, in particular Apple, announced the suspension of deliveries to the Russian Federation.
According to Price.ru, a service for comparing goods and prices, in the first three weeks since the start of the special operation, prices for household appliances in Russian online stores increased by an average of 50%. During this period, the price of Apple products increased by 13-142%, Samsung equipment – by 12-53%.
Against the background of rising prices, the FAS began to control sellers of household appliances and electronics “Technopark-Center” and DNS. At the same time, demand for used equipment in the country increased by 16-35% in March, according to data from ad placement services.
Machine prices began to decline in April. According to Price.ru, the prices of the most popular models of smartphones and laptops in Russian online stores fell by an average of 10-20% in April compared to March.
